Home > Store

Programming in Objective-C 2.0 LiveLessons (Video Training): Part I Language Fundamentals and Part II iPhone Programming and the Foundation Framework, Video Download

Programming in Objective-C 2.0 LiveLessons (Video Training): Part I Language Fundamentals and Part II iPhone Programming and the Foundation Framework, Video Download

Downloadable Video

  • Your Price: $119.99
  • List Price: $149.99
  • About this video
  • Accessible from your Account page after purchase. Requires the free QuickTime Player software.

    Videos can be viewed on: Windows 8, Windows XP, Vista, 7, and all versions of Macintosh OS X including the iPad, and other platforms that support the industry standard h.264 video codec.

Additional sample videos, individual lessons and other formats are available here.

Register your product to gain access to bonus material or receive a coupon.

Audio & Video


Watch a sample video from this product.

You need to upgrade your Flash Player. You need version 9 or above to view this video. You may download it here. You may also see this message if you have JavaScript turned off. If this is the case, please enable JavaScript and reload the page.


  • Copyright 2010
  • Edition: 1st
  • Downloadable Video
  • ISBN-10: 0-13-210072-X
  • ISBN-13: 978-0-13-210072-4

Programming in Objective-C 2.0 LiveLessons is the world’s first complete video training course on the basics of Objective-C, the programming language at the heart of Mac OS X and iPhone/iPad development.

Bestselling author and trainer Stephen G. Kochan provides the new programmer with a step-by-step, hands-on introduction to the Objective-C language and the fundamentals of object-oriented programming.

The course does not assume any previous programming experience and includes many detailed, practical examples of how to put Objective-C to use in everyday programming tasks for the Mac OS X and iPhone/iPad platforms.

Stephen G. Kochan is author of the bestselling book Programming in Objective-C 2.0 and author or co-author of several bestselling books on the C language, including Programming in C, Programming in ANSI C, and Topics in C Programming. He has been programming Macintosh computers since the introduction of the first Mac in 1984, and he wrote Programming C for the Mac.

Part I: Language Fundamentals

1: Getting Started in Objective-C [00:14:00]

2: Classes, Objects, and Methods [00:43:03]

3: Data Types and Expressions [00:41:00]

4: Loops [00:23:19]

5: Making Decisions [00:37:20]

6: More On Classes [00:43:36]

7: Inheritance [00:45:48]

8: Polymorphism, Dynamic Typing, and Dynamic Binding [00:23:12]

9: More on Variables and Data Types [00:29:10]

10: Categories and Protocols [00:39:25]

11: The Preprocessor [00:37.24]

12: Underlying C Language Features [01:43:03]

Part II: iPhone Programming and the Foundation Framework

1: Introduction to the Foundation Framework [00:08:31]

2: Numbers and Strings [00:37:24]

3: Collections [01:26:56]

4: Working with Files [00:52:07]

5: Memory Management [00:40:13]

6: Copying Objects [00:35:58]

7: Archiving Objects [00:27:38]

8: Introduction to iPhone/iPod Touch Programming [00:34:46]

9: Writing an iPhone Fraction Calculator [00:36:45]


Submit Errata

More Information

Unlimited one-month access with your purchase
Free Safari Membership